Common Reasons for Early Access Issues
If you find that MLB The Show 24 early access is not working for you, there are several factors that could be at play. Here, we will outline some of the most common issues users might face:
1. Pre-Order Status Verification
One of the primary reasons why MLB The Show 24 early access might not be functioning is related to the pre-order status. It’s essential to ensure that your pre-order was successfully processed. Here are some key points to verify:
- Confirmation Email: Check your email for a confirmation from the retailer or PlayStation. If you don’t see a confirmation, it’s possible that the transaction was not completed.
- Game Library: On your console, navigate to your game library. If MLB The Show 24 is not listed under your games, it may indicate that the pre-order didn’t go through correctly.
2. Server Issues
Another common cause of early access problems could be server-related issues. When a highly anticipated game launches, millions of players often log in simultaneously, leading to potential strain on the servers. Here’s what to consider:
- Server Status: Before assuming the problem is on your end, check the official MLB The Show Twitter account or website for any announcements regarding server downtime.
- Connection Speeds: Slow internet connections can also contribute to issues when trying to access multiplayer features or even starting the game itself. Ensure you have a stable connection by testing your internet speed.
3. Platform-Specific Problems
Depending on whether you are using a PlayStation, Xbox, or PC, issues may vary across platforms. Here’s how to troubleshoot platform-specific problems:
For PlayStation Users
- System Updates: Ensure your console software is up to date. Delaying updates can hinder your ability to access online features.
- Account Issues: Log out and back into your PlayStation Network account as it can refresh your access.
For Xbox Users
- Game Updates: Xbox systems often require game updates before you can access early features. Check for any available updates.
- Account Verification: Confirm that you are logged in with the correct account that made the pre-order.
For PC Users
- Game Client Issues: If you are using a client like Steam or the Epic Games Store, ensure that the game is properly installed and all necessary updates have been applied.
- Permissions: Sometimes, user account control settings may restrict access. Running the client as an administrator can resolve issues.
Troubleshooting Steps to Fix Early Access Problems
If you’ve encountered problems with MLB The Show 24 early access, here are detailed troubleshooting steps to help resolve the issues:
Step 1: Confirm Your Purchase
As mentioned previously, confirming your purchase is critical. Check your email for a purchase confirmation and inspect your game library. Make sure the game is installed properly.
Step 2: Restart Your Console or PC
Sometimes, all it takes to fix a glitch or connectivity issue is a good old-fashioned restart. By restarting your system, you refresh applications and clear any temporary glitches that might be causing issues.
Step 3: Check for Updates
Make sure both your console and the game itself are up to date. For consoles, navigate to the game on your dashboard, press the options button, and look for an update. On PC platforms, check the game client for updates.
Step 4: Test Your Internet Connection
A stable and fast internet connection is essential for accessing online features:
- Wired vs. Wireless: If you’re on a wireless connection, consider switching to a wired connection for a more stable gaming experience.
- Speed Test: Perform a speed test to ensure your connection is fast enough to handle online gameplay.
Step 5: Reach Out to Support
If you’ve followed the previous steps and still have not gained access, it may be time to reach out for help. Contacting customer support can often lead to identification of the problem. Prepare to provide your order confirmation number, details related to your console, and a description of the issue.

Why am I unable to access MLB The Show 24 Early Access?
If you’re unable to access MLB The Show 24 Early Access, the first thing to check is your eligibility. Early Access is typically tied to certain pre-order bonuses or subscription services. Ensure that you have either pre-ordered the game through a participating retailer or have an active subscription to the required service.
Another reason for access issues could be related to your platform’s account settings. Ensure that your account is set up correctly, with any necessary payment or subscription information confirmed. Sometimes, regional restrictions can also affect access, so verifying your current location in relation to the game’s release can be helpful as well.

What features are typically included in Early Access for MLB The Show 24?
Early Access often includes all or most game modes, allowing players a chance to experience the full potential of MLB The Show 24. This includes Franchise mode, Diamond Dynasty, and Road to the Show, along with any new elements introduced in this iteration. Some editions may also come with exclusive packs or digital items that enhance the gameplay experience.
Additionally, players can expect to access improved graphics, new mechanics, and updated rosters during Early Access. This allows players to get a comprehensive understanding of what to expect in the final release, which has proven to be an exciting aspect of participating in Early Access programs.
